Fans Plan to Obtain Dreamcast Beta of Toejam & Earl 3 to Release Online

October 23rd, 2013

The recently discovered beta of Toejam & Earl 3 for Dreamcast could be released online. The owner has revealed himself on the Assembler Games forum and is running a fundraiser in order to raise a certain amount of money before a digital version of the beta is released in the wild.

Details of The Creative Assembly’s Aliens Game Leak

October 22nd, 2013

As per SEGA’s recent strategy for the West, the company will be publishing more games using the Aliens IP. It was revealed a while back that The Creative Assembly would be making a game but today we finally have the first details as to what the game will be.

Kotaku have discovered that The Creative Assembly will create a game called Alien: Isolation. The new game will be a FPS due for release in 2014 and will be a cross-generational title.

The game is also supposed to take the form of a stealth/horror title and play similarly to games like Bioshock and Dishonored. You also play as Amanda Ripley; Ellen Ripley’s daughter.

SEGA are hoping to make up for the bad reception of Aliens: Colonial Marines by giving The Creative Assembly plenty of time to develop the title and have already delayed the game’s announcement from a proposed E3 reveal.

Sonic 2 Remastered Coming to iOS and Android in November

October 21st, 2013

The next in Christian ‘Taxman’ Whitehead’s Retro Engine Sonic remasters is Sonic the Hedgehog 2 and the game is coming to iOS and Android devices this November.

Also confirmed is a scaled down version of Sonic & All-Stars Racing Transformed also for iOS and Android. This title is being released in December and features a new World Tour mode exclusive to this version.

House of the Dead Sale on PSN

October 16th, 2013

The House of the Dead games on PSN have been put on sale on the PSN store. You can now grab House of the Dead III, 4 and Overkill for the following prices:

The House of the Dead III: £2.39 or £1.79 for PS+ subscribers
The House of the Dead4: £3.24 or £2.43 for PS+ subscribers
The House of the Dead Overkill – Extended Cut: £6.39 or £4.79 for PS+ subscribers

Alternatively a bundle of all 3 can be grabbed for £7.99 or £5.99 for PS+ subscribers.
